Personal Profile:

Yue Song received B.S. and M.S. degrees from Shanghai Jiao Tong University, in 2011 and 2014, respectively, and the Ph.D. degree from The University of Hong Kong (HKU), in 2017, all in electrical engineering. He was a Postdoctoral Fellow at HKU from Sep 2017 to Apr 2020. He is currently a Research Assistant Professor in the Department of Electrical and Electronic Engineering at HKU. He is a recipient of the Hong Kong Ph.D. Fellowship. He serves as an Area Editor for EAI Endorsed Transactions on Energy Web, and a guest editor for Frontiers in Energy Research, Energies, and Complexity. His research interests include control theory, optimization theory, and network science with applications to energy systems and network systems.

Abstract:

Power flow Jacobian singularity is an important characterization for voltage stability limit. n this talk, a necessary and sufficient condition for power flow Jacobian singularity in distribution systems is established with the application of Wirtinger derivative. This condition can be interpreted as a generalization of the admittance matching condition in the single-load infinite- bus system, showing the role of power network, loads and DGs in voltage stability. In addition, a new voltage stability index is proposed based on this singularity condition. Numerical simulations on IEEE test systems verify that this index has good linearity with load increase and estimates voltage stability margin with high precision.
